Day 3 - Part 2 - Utah and Colorado

Day 2 continued!
Naturally we decided on the circuitous route and launched in to Monument Valley.
Tom recognized one vista as the Eagles Album cover:

And decided that we should replicate this photo from the middle of the road.  Good idea Tom.  Safety first. 

I did not successfully ditch him in the road, so after meandering through the truly stunning park we decided to stop for lunch in Twin Rocks Utah. We had lunch next to this trading post, where I made the ill-advised decision to get a "Navajo Taco" which was basically a giant fried donut/taco covered with beans and cheese.  Weird. But I digress. 

Clarisse really did well today, with only a few weird noises. Tom was so happy he took this car commercial product quality shot of her: 

Making our way back down from Utah, we decided to forego the Four Corners park and head north to Telluride.  As soon as we got in to Colorado, the topography changed completely, as did the weather. Storm brewing. 

And then the storm hit us.  We drove through pounding hail, lightning, and then snow, which turned to rain just outside Telluride. 

We made it in to town, walking through the rain and stopping at the local saloon for a beer and some food. 
And finally we pushed on toward Grand Junction, stopping for what was a perfect sunset to bookend the glorious sunrise.
